From the following information, calculate the opening and Closing Trade Payables:
Cash Purchases 25% of Total Purchases; Revenue from Operations ₹ 3,00,000; Gross Profit 25% on Revenue from Operations; Opening Inventory ₹ 75,000; Closing Inventory ₹ 1,50,000; Trade Payables Turnover Ratio 3 Times; Closing Trade Payables were ₹ 75,000 in excess of Opening Trade Payables.
Hints:
1. Cost of Revenue from Operations = ₹ 2,25,000.
2. Total Purchases = Cost of Revenue from Operations + Closing Inventory − Opening Inventory
= ₹ 2,25,000 + ₹ 1,50,000 − ₹ 75,000
= ₹ 3,00,000
3. Net Credit Purchases = Total Purchases − Cash Purchases
= ₹ 3,00,000 − ₹ 75,000
= ₹ 2,25,000

Calculation of Cost of Revenue from Operations:
\[\text{Gross Profit} = 25\% \text{ of } ₹ 3,00,000 = ₹ 75,000\]
$$\text{Cost of Revenue from Operations} = \text{Revenue from Operations} - \text{Gross Profit}$$
$$\text{Cost of Revenue from Operations} = ₹ 3,00,000 - ₹ 75,000$$
$${\text{Cost of Revenue from Operations} = ₹ 2,25,000}$$
Calculation of Total Purchases:
$$\text{Cost of Revenue from Operations} = \text{Opening Inventory} + \text{Total Purchases} - \text{Closing Inventory}$$
$$2,25,000 = 75,000 + \text{Total Purchases} - 1,50,000$$
$$2,25,000 = \text{Total Purchases} - 75,000$$
$$\text{Total Purchases} = 2,25,000 + 75,000$$
$${\text{Total Purchases} = ₹ 3,00,000}$$
Calculation of Net Credit Purchases:
$$\text{Cash Purchases} = 25\% \text{ of } ₹ 3,00,000 = ₹ 75,000$$
$$\text{Net Credit Purchases} = \text{Total Purchases} - \text{Cash Purchases}$$
$$\text{Net Credit Purchases} = ₹ 3,00,000 - ₹ 75,000$$
$${\text{Net Credit Purchases} = ₹ 2,25,000}$$
Calculation of Average Trade Payables:
$$\text{Trade Payables Turnover Ratio} = \frac{\text{Net Credit Purchases}}{\text{Average Trade Payables}}$$
$$3 = \frac{2,25,000}{\text{Average Trade Payables}}$$
$$\text{Average Trade Payables} = \frac{2,25,000}{3}$$
$${\text{Average Trade Payables} = ₹ 75,000}$$
Calculation of Opening and Closing Trade Payables:
Let Opening Trade Payables be $x$.
Therefore, Closing Trade Payables = $x + 75,000$
$$\text{Average Trade Payables} = \frac{\text{Opening Trade Payables} + \text{Closing Trade Payables}}{2}$$
$$75,000 = \frac{x + (x + 75,000)}{2}$$
$$75,000 \times 2 = 2x + 75,000$$
$$1,50,000 = 2x + 75,000$$
$$2x = 1,50,000 - 75,000$$
$$2x = 75,000$$
$$x = \frac{75,000}{2}$$
$${\text{Opening Trade Payables } (x) = ₹ 37,500}$$
$$\text{Closing Trade Payables} = x + 75,000$$
$$\text{Closing Trade Payables} = 37,500 + 75,000$$
$${\text{Closing Trade Payables} = ₹ 1,12,500}$$
